Adding an Embedded Style Sheet
• It is useful to understand how you can structure your Web page by dividing it into logical sections
• The CSS box model describes the structure of the elements that are displayed on the Web page
• The margin specifies the space between the element and other content on the Web page
• The border is what surrounds the element content• The padding is the space between the content of
the element and the box borderChapter 7: Using Advanced Cascading Style Sheets 10
